5. Maybe I'm too cynical these days.
All I see is PR manipulation of a new Wal-Mart money-saving scheme. They're "going green" or they're trying to cut energy costs because of increasing fossil fuel prices? My money's on the latter.

Whatever their motivation, I'm glad they're doing it. However, it does not raise them in my estimation at all -- not until they clean up their horrendous labor and business practices -- and I still will not set foot in their stores.

Btw, they also announced that they'll be using corn-based plastics in their packaging, which also sounds like a very good thing -- until you learn that the plastic will be coming from GM corn and produced by Cargill Dow.
Source: http://www.treehugger.com/files/2005/10/walmart_to_use.php

I applaud every effort any company makes toward being more environmentally responsible, but I loathe manipulative greenwashing PR.
